As much as I'd love a new convert, this one probably isn't for you, Turjan. While Wiz8 has a decent story, that's not the point of the game. It's all about character development. The vehicle for growth (and the gage for progress) is combat, plain and simple.

It's very well-designed combat though. :) I like both story and combat elements, but they seldom seem to go hand in hand in RPGs--you usually get one at the expense of the other, like Arcanum;great story, crappy to adequate combat and yes, Wiz8; great combat and fantastic character development, but only adequate story--though actually Wiz8 has a better story than Arcanum has combat. ;)

There is one noticable disadvantage with playing a moded version of the game, and that is that new npc's with new dialog are voiceless bacause obviously you cannot have new sound files magically appear for new text that you give an npc.
But if a mod is good you quickley get used to this.
